Order of Merit – This year we are introducing an Order of Merit competition to PEGS End of Month events. This is to principally recognise those members who regularly play competitions and perhaps are not in the winners circle all the time but support the Society month in month out. The OOM points will be calculated from the results of each of the end of month tournaments. Winners from each category will be awarded points for placing in the top 5, and all players competing will also receive bonus points for participating in the tournaments. Don't worry if you have a couple of bad tournaments, as we will only record each person's best 8 results throughout the year. This also means that if you are away from Phuket you will still be eligible for the OOM providing that you play in a minimum of 8 EOM Tournaments in the OOM competition year. While the results will only be taken from 8 events, every player will receive an attendance point for all of Tournaments that they play in the OOM year. The above text is the final draft of the proposed Order of Merit system which will be confirmed at the August committee meeting. We will announce the winners of the three divisions at the PEGS AGM in March 2011, the OOM competition year therefore will run from March 2010 to February 2011. Handicapping – Since our last communication on the subject of the CONGU handicapping system, which PEGS utilises, we have made some refinements. Your committee have changed some of the parameters such as the buffer zone which dictates how handicaps move up. While golfers having a really bad day will still see their handicaps rise, those playing just above their handicaps will more likely remain where they are. Our aim as a social organisation is for everyone to enjoy the tournaments, and for all to have an equal chance of winning. We hope these changes will result in a wider spread of winners and a fairer representation of handicaps, remembering always that your handicap should be an indication of your potential, and not what you regularly score.
